Viva Vivier
Claire Vivier will be making an appearance with her namesake line of stylish Italian leather bags Thursday at Laguna Supply in Laguna Beach from noon to 4 p.m. Her handbag collection, exclusively made in Los Angeles, is garnering attention globally for its chic styles that combine modern details with classic shapes. Choose from totes, ipod cases, clutches, wallets, sacs, travel totes and even leather wrist wraps. Her pieces come in an array of beautiful colors including hot pink, grey, aqua, green patent, orange, red, caramel and black.
We especially love the zip wallet clutches with vibrant colored interiors—black-Kelly green, caramel-sky blue, and red-teal. Laguna Supply offers a well-edited selection of hip apparel and accessories, plus it’s having a 30 to 50% off summer sale through the end of the month. Some top labels on sale include Rag & Bone, Isabel Marant, Alexander Wang T, ALC, Vince, Current Elliott.
Other popular items (excluded from the sale) include cover ups from Lem Lem and CP Shades, Tucker blouses and dresses, as well as Mother Jeans.
Open 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. Monday through Saturday;11 a.m. to 5 p.m. Sunday.
Laguna Supply is at 210 Beach St. in Laguna Beach. 949.497.8850.
